Chandu wins gold in Nepal, thanks KTR for support

Hyderabad: Bolugula Chandu, a 19-year-old from Jangaon, won a gold medal in Kung Fu category of the 5th International Nepal Games Heroes Cup on Saturday after defeating his Korean opponent 5-4 in the final.

However, a few days ago, his participation was in doubt with Chandu struggling to pool in required amount for his travel. Thanks to the timely intervention of K T Rama Rao, Minister for Municipal Administration and Urban Development, Industries & Commerce, Chandu not only made it to the tournament but returned with flying colours.


Chandu needed over 25,000 for his travel to the tournament. He released a note asking for donors and tagged KTR on twitter. The Minster swung into action immediately, alerting Office of KTR who arranged the amount for his travel. “Thanks to KTR sir for the support. I could travel to the tournament because of the money he arranged for me. I was determined to perform well after the support. I wanted to bring laurels to the State and the country and I am happy I could do that,” said Chandu from Nepal.

Chandu made it to the Indian team after winning in the national meet in Goa. The Degree first year student of Sainik College, Warangal, defeated his opponent from Bhutan 5-3 in the first round and Nepal 5-3 in the semifinals. He then downed Korean opponent 5-4 in the summit clash for the yellow medal.

Chandu, who started playing karate when he was in the eighth class in his hometown in Bachannapet village in Jangaon district because of his master Doddi Sreenu, wants to bring more laurels to the country and needs financial assistance for his dream.
